NIST Version 1.1. The NIST Cybersecurity Framework organizes its "core" material into five "functions" which are subdivided into a total of 23 "categories". For each category, it defines a number of subcategories of cybersecurity outcomes and security controls, with 108 subcategories in all.

Published in September 2006, the NIST SP 800-92 Guide to Computer Security Log Management serves as a key document within the NIST Risk Management Framework to guide what should be auditable. As indicated by the absence of the term "SIEM", the document was released before the widespread adoption of SIEM technologies.

NIST Special Publication 800-53 is an information security standard that provides a catalog of privacy and security controls for information systems.Originally intended for U.S. federal agencies except those related to national security, since the 5th revision it is a standard for general usage.
President Barack Obama issued Executive Order 13636, [7] "Improving Critical Infrastructure Cybersecurity", in February 2013 tasking NIST to create a cybersecurity framework that helps organizations mitigate risks to the nation's essential systems such as power generation and distribution, the financial services sector, and transportation.
NIST performs its statutory responsibilities through the Computer Security Division of the Information Technology Laboratory. [4] NIST develops standards, metrics, tests, and validation programs to promote, measure, and validate the security in information systems and services.
